£66,500 grant for First World War memorial project in Somerset

$
0
0
A project to mark the 100th anniversary of the First World War has been launched by Somerset Heritage Service following a grant of £66,500 from the Heritage Lottery Fund. Drawing on this poignant anniversary, the Somerset Remembers project will explore the impact and long-term effects of the conflict on Somerset, and will look at the many ways in which Somerset people, their families and communities have remembered the war. Somerset Remembers will pay tribute to the sacrifices made by Somerset people both during and after the First World War. It will also help people today to learn about the impact of the war. The project's centrepiece will be a major exhibition at The Museum of Somerset, which will open in August 2014. A touring exhibition will visit other venues across the county. There will be many opportunities for people to get involved in the project, either through volunteering, sharing memories, records or artefacts, or through participating in a wide range of activities and events. Activities will include talks, open days, object handling, readings, re-enactments and drop-in sessions for people to bring in items for inclusion in a community archive. There will also be a programme of special events including a football match on a memorial playing field and a special concert. Tom Mayberry, Somerset's heritage officer, said: "It seems appropriate and very important that we should remember the First World War and what it meant for Somerset people. "We are very grateful to the Heritage Lottery Fund for the generous support they are giving to the project." As part of the project, a team of volunteers at the Somerset Heritage Centre will digitise and transcribe First World War documents.
